Hilbert II swMATH ID: 5516 Software Authors: m31 Description: The goal of Hilbert II, which is in the tradition of Hilbert’s program, is the creation of a system that enables a working mathematician to put theorems and proofs (in the formal language of predicate calculus) into it. These proofs are automatically verified by a proof checker. Because this system is not centrally administered and enables references to any location on the Internet, a world wide mathematical knowledge base could be built. It also contains information in ”common mathematical language”.
